solverstate的使用
http://blog.csdn.net/wang4959520/article/details/51831637
我們在使用caffe訓練過程中會生成.caffemodel和.solverstate文件,一個是模型文件,一個是中間狀態文件(生成多少個取決于你自己設定的snapshot)。當訓練過程中斷,你想繼續運行數據學習,此時只需要調用.solverstate文件即可。
使用方式代碼,我使用的是.sh直接運行,配置和官方給的文件train_caffenet.sh差不多,稍微添加點內容就可以了。
[plain]?view plain?copy ?
上述配置根據個人文件路徑實際情況相應修改即可。
The solverstate file, as its name conveys, stores the state of the solver and not any information related to classification results. The model is saved as caffemodel file, which you can use to obtain classification results for your data. If you want to fine-tune your network you may use a pre-trained caffemodel file. This will save time as your network does not need to learn from scratch. But, in case your present training needs to be halted, due to a power cut or an unexpected reboot, you may resume your training form the previous snapshot of the solverstate. The difference between using the solverstate and the caffemodel files is that the former allows you to complete your training in the pre-determined manner while the latter may require changes in certain training parameters such as the maximum number of iterations.
總結
以上是生活随笔為你收集整理的solverstate的使用的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 湿热与寒湿的区别
- 下一篇: 准确率、召回率、F1、mAP、ROC、A